Question
Which Indian Prime Minister was the first to lead a
coalition government at the national level?Solution
Chandra Shekhar made history as the first Prime Minister of India to head a coalition government at the central level. His brief tenure from 10th November 1990 to 21st June 1991 was marked by his reputation as a "Young Turk" and his critical role in preventing India from defaulting on sovereign repayments.
